Output 104c101cc7978dd93b1a74f38458f9fb79b30c23230f5e5342438dad534fb325:0

value
370862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5a89591ac0938f7a8177b911c6fb664ffbde81c OP_EQUAL
address
3Q5wRyt7LSjJL6zMRRqZ7Cb9H1aZQ84GcB
transaction
104c101cc7978dd93b1a74f38458f9fb79b30c23230f5e5342438dad534fb325
spent
true